I Robert Dunbar assist (assistant) Surveyor aforesd [aforesaid] do hereby certify that upon careful examination
I find the foregoing duties amount to the Sum of £22 5 Stg [Sterling] and that
the 25th day of Janry [January] 1790 I sent by one of the Dumfs [Dumfries] Carriers to [Mr Francis]
Maxwell Collr [Collector] for the Burgh aforesaid, an exact duplicate of this account
which contained my oath that the preceeding inhts [inhabitants] were duly served
requisitions of the Dates foresaid, and that they are charged according to
Several returns to me, as to the best information I could procure.
Robert Dunbar assist (assistant) Surveyor

Scottish Exchequer (Tax Records), Female servant tax - Volume 19 - Burghs (A-F) (see 'More info' for burgh details), E326/6/19
Volume 19 contains female servant tax rolls for the following burghs: Aberdeen, Annan, Anstruther Easter, Anstruther Wester, Arbroath, Ayr, Banff, Brechin, Burntisland, Campbeltown, Crail, Cullen, Culross, Cupar, Dingwall, Dumbarton, Dumfries, Dunbar, Dundee, Dunfermline, Dysart, Edinburgh, Elgin, Forfar, Forres, and Fortrose.
Scottish Exchequer (Tax Records)
The Scottish Exchequer, and subsequently the Court of Exchequer, were concerned with the accounting of collected taxes in Scotland. These taxes include the Carriage tax (1785-1798), Cart tax (1785-1798), Clock and watch tax (1797-1798), Dog tax (1797-1798), Farm horse tax (1797-1798), Servant tax (1777-1798), Hearth tax (1691-1695), Horse tax (1785-1798), Inhabited house tax (1778-1798), Land tax (1645-1831), Poll tax (1694-1698), Shop tax (1785-1789), Window tax (1748-1798). Following the Consolidating Acts (38 Geo. III cap. 40 and 41), the duties on windows, inhabited houses, male servants, carts, carriages and dogs were incorporated in Consolidated Schedules of Assessed Taxes (1798-1799).
